    Can you construct a loft using oriented strand board?

    Oriented strand board, commonly known as OSB, is a structural panel made up of wood strands that are bonded together with wax and resin adhesives. It is known for its strength, versatility, and cost-effectiveness. OSB is manufactured by layering and cross-oriented strands in specific patterns, resulting in a durable product with excellent dimensional stability.

    The Benefits of Using OSB for Loft Construction:

    1. Strength and Structural Stability:

    One of the key advantages of using OSB for loft construction is its remarkable strength. OSB panels have a high load-bearing capacity, making them suitable for supporting the weight of a loft structure. They offer great dimensional stability, minimizing the risk of sagging or warping over time.

    2. Easy Installation and Customization:

    OSB panels are available in a variety of sizes and thicknesses, allowing for easy customization to fit the specific requirements of your loft space. These panels are relatively lightweight, making them easier to handle and install compared to other materials such as plywood or solid wood. They can be easily cut, allowing for precise fitting and ease of construction.

    3. Cost-Effective:

    Cost-effectiveness is a significant advantage of using OSB for loft construction. It is typically less expensive than other building materials, such as plywood or solid wood. With OSB, you can achieve the same structural integrity at a lower cost, making it an attractive option, especially for those on a tight budget.

    4. Environmental Sustainability:

    OSB is an environmentally sustainable choice for loft construction. The manufacturing process of OSB utilizes wood strands that are often sourced from fast-growing, renewable forests. Additionally, the adhesives used in OSB production are generally formaldehyde-free, resulting in lower emissions and fewer health concerns compared to other composite wood products.

    Considerations and Potential Drawbacks:

    1. Moisture Sensitivity:

    One limitation of OSB is its sensitivity to moisture. While it performs well in dry environments, prolonged exposure to moisture can cause the wood strands to swell and delaminate. Therefore, it is crucial to ensure proper ventilation and moisture control within the loft space to prevent damage to the OSB panels.

    2. Limited Aesthetic Appeal:

    Compared to other materials like solid wood or plywood, OSB may not offer the same aesthetic appeal. OSB has a distinct appearance with its layered texture and strands. However, this potential drawback can be mitigated by painting or applying a finish to the OSB panels, allowing for a more polished and visually appealing loft interior.

    Oriented strand board (OSB) proves to be a viable option for constructing a loft due to its strength, cost-effectiveness, and flexibility. When used properly and in the right environmental conditions, OSB can provide an excellent alternative to traditional materials. Its affordability and ease of installation make it an attractive choice, especially for those looking to build a loft on a tight budget. However, it is essential to consider the potential moisture sensitivity and limited aesthetic appeal of OSB when making a decision.
